Abstract

Online learning is promoted by the Malaysian Government as a key element in the Higher Education Blueprint 2015-25 (Shift 9: Globalized Online Learning), but research in the Malaysian context is very underdeveloped. This chapter aims to fill part of this gap with a simple analysis of online Master of Business Administration (MBA) courses to examine the appetite and preferences of actual and potential MBA students for online learning. Using data from local and international students studying on MBA programs in Malaysia, the authors show that the MBA students in their sample still have a largely instrumental view of the value drivers of their study programs. The key factors identified by the largest number of groups were facilities, price, certificate authenticity, duration, and flexibility of course times.
